People Operations (POps) Central is an organization set up to provide services to the enablement of People Operations. Our mission is ‘’To power People Ops to create exceptional experiences.’’ The teams represented within POps Central are HR Operations (providing support to every user group along each stage of the employee lifecycle), Extended Workforce Solutions (managing our extended workforce and vendor network), Strategy, Planning, and Integration, Integrity (compliance and risk management) and Core (planning, operations, and communications).
HR Operations is a key pillar within POps Central. This team creates simple and exceptional experiences at scale for Googlers and Candidates by running operational services across 70+ countries with the ultimate goal of making HR easy and intuitive. Our global team optimizes people processes, from problem definition to execution, and we partner with teams across POps to bring innovation and technology to the way we attract, retain, and grow Googlers worldwide.
